**Handover — Bramblehook API pagination**

Hi! Taking over cursor pagination on the Bramblehook public REST API. Cursors are opaque, base-encoded offsets; don't let clients parse them. The /listings endpoint still uses page numbers — migrate it last. Staging credentials sit in the Foxden vault; to open it, use the recovery phrase just below.

strongbox words: norwyn-wenael-aldvan-aldiel-wendor-holael

Ticket: FirmFlow staging misconfigured. Devices on the beta update channel are pulling production firmware because staging's .env points at the wrong channel endpoint. Fix: set UPDATE_CHANNEL=beta and restart the publisher. The publisher also fails auth after restart because the channel token was never migrated; add it directly below this line.

vault entry, yahif-yajep: COURIER_KEY29=b802bdf8034096b65a51c6ba5abe2

# Constants for the Inkrun markdown rendering pipeline. These govern
# parser recursion depth, sanitizer passes, and render-cache TTLs for
# the Pagewright docs site. Changing any of them invalidates the cache
# fleet-wide, so bundle changes with a release and note it in the
# changelog. Values shipping in the current release are:

tuning constants:
TIERS = {
    "sorion": 670,
    "istax": 547,
}